Forum Discussion
Brian_Saunders1
Mar 07, 2014Altostratus
ProxyPass Appending "/" to URI 404 Error
Hey All,
Need a bit of assistance here, thinking this should be an easy fix but I can't figure it out. Testing out the ProxyPass iRule so that when the end users enters a URL they get redirected b...
Brian_Saunders1
Mar 07, 2014Altostratus
So I updated your iRule to what you suggested and it's still adding the "/" to the end of the uri, here's the log:
Mar 7 07:19:08 local/tmm info tmm[4929]: Rule ProxyPass : devpasswordreset.environment.dev_443: 10.67.36.185:56223 -> 172.30.25.84:443
Mar 7 07:19:08 local/tmm info tmm[4929]: Rule ProxyPass : VS=devpasswordreset.environment.dev_443, Host=devpasswordreset.environment.dev, URI=/: Found Rule, Client Host=devpasswordreset.environment.dev, Client Path=/, Server Host=devpasswordreset.environment.dev, Server Path=/rdweb/pages/en-us/devpassword.aspx/
Mar 7 07:19:08 local/tmm info tmm[4929]: Rule ProxyPass : VS=devpasswordreset.environment.dev_443, Host=devpasswordreset.environment.dev, URI=/: Using default pool devpasswordreset.environment.dev_80
Mar 7 07:19:08 local/tmm info tmm[4929]: Rule ProxyPass : VS=devpasswordreset.environment.dev_443, Host=devpasswordreset.environment.dev, URI=/: New Host=devpasswordreset.environment.dev, New Path=/rdweb/pages/en-us/devpassword.aspx/
Mar 7 07:19:08 local/tmm info tmm[4929]: Rule ProxyPass : VS=devpasswordreset.environment.dev_443, Host=devpasswordreset.environment.dev, URI=/: Removed Accept-Encoding header
Mar 7 07:19:08 local/tmm info tmm[4929]: Rule ProxyPass : VS=devpasswordreset.environment.dev_443, Host=devpasswordreset.environment.dev, URI=/: 404 response from devpasswordreset.environment.dev_80 172.30.26.98 80
Mar 7 07:19:08 local/tmm info tmm[4929]: Rule ProxyPass : VS=devpasswordreset.environment.dev_443, Host=devpasswordreset.environment.dev, URI=/: $stream_expression_cmd: STREAM::expression "@devpasswordreset.environment.dev/rdweb/pages/en-us/devpassword.aspx/@devpasswordreset.environment.dev/@ @/rdweb/pages/en-us/devpassword.aspx/@/@", $stream_enable_cmd: STREAM::enable
Mar 7 07:19:08 local/tmm info tmm[4929]: Rule ProxyPass : VS=devpasswordreset.environment.dev_443, Host=devpasswordreset.environment.dev, URI=/: Successfully configured and enabled stream filter
Mar 7 07:19:08 local/tmm info tmm[4929]: Rule ProxyPass : VS=devpasswordreset.environment.dev_443, Host=devpasswordreset.environment.dev, URI=/: Checking Location=, $protocol=
Mar 7 07:19:08 local/tmm info tmm[4929]: Rule ProxyPass : VS=devpasswordreset.environment.dev_443, Host=devpasswordreset.environment.dev, URI=/: Checking Content-Location=, $protocol=
Mar 7 07:19:08 local/tmm info tmm[4929]: Rule ProxyPass : VS=devpasswordreset.environment.dev_443, Host=devpasswordreset.environment.dev, URI=/: Checking URI=, $protocol=
My datagroup is setup like
/ := devpasswordreset.environment.dev/rdweb/pages/en-us/devpassword.aspx
- Mar 07, 2014If someone else doesn't answer I'll try to study the rule and have an answer next Monday. But it's way more complex than I'm used to so I hope I'm not in over my head. :)
Recent Discussions
Related Content
DevCentral Quicklinks
* Getting Started on DevCentral
* Community Guidelines
* Community Terms of Use / EULA
* Community Ranking Explained
* Community Resources
* Contact the DevCentral Team
* Update MFA on account.f5.com
Discover DevCentral Connects